LTD bus routes in Eugene to see reductions as bus driver shortage worsens

Citing a lack of bus drivers, the Lane Transit District announced this week a reduction in service scheduled to go into effect on Monday.

"The reason for the service adjustment is simple: LTD needs more bus operators," LTD Chief Marketing Officer Pat Walsh said in a written announcement. Walsh said LTD is "in the midst of a massive recruitment and retention effort" and hopes to bring back service later. The new timetables are scheduled to last until June 15.

Walsh told the Register-Guard LTD currently employs 170 bus operators, but had 215 before the pandemic, and the district is hiring for 100 more because of expected retirements and for flexibility around leave.

"We are in a continuous hiring mode," for not only drivers but also mechanics and public safety officers, he said.

No routes were removed under the new schedule, but several will now feature less frequent trips. The largest reductions include to the EmX and to routes serving Springfield, Bethel and north Eugene. LTD also included some non-reduction alterations to times and routes.

EmX

Removal of the midday Franklin corridor trips. Under the old schedule, EmX busses would make additional trips along the portion of the route between the Eugene and Springfield stations so that for parts of the afternoon the wait time between buses was 7.5 minutes. Now those Franklin corridor trips are removed and the EmX runs every 15 minutes during weekday afternoons.

Route 11 - Thurston

Removal of the 6:40 p.m., 7:40 p.m., 10 p.m., and 11 p.m. trips and adjusted time points so that on weekdays the bus now runs every half hour instead of every 20 minutes from 6 to 8 p.m., and every hour instead of every half hour after 9:30 p.m.

Route 12 - Gateway

Removal of the 9 a.m. and 6 p.m. weekday trips.

Route 17 - 5th Street/Hayden Bridge

Removal of the 6 a.m. and 8:25 a.m. trips, and adjusted other trips to be more evenly spaced out.

Route 18 - Mohawk

Removal of the 10 p.m. trip, the last one of the day.

Route 24 - Donald

Removal of the 6 p.m. trip and the routing where three morning trips were previously extended to 8th and Olive.

Route 28 - Hilyard

No reduction in service, but the route now turns onto 14th Avenue instead of 15th Avenue as it leaves UO station.

Route 36 - W 18th

Removal of the 2:45 p.m. weekday trip.

Route 40 - W Echo Hollow

Removal of the 4:15 p.m. and 6 p.m. weekday trips.

Route 41 - Barger/Commerce

Removal of the 4:15 p.m. and 4:45 p.m. weekday trips.

Route 55 - North Park

An adjustment to the afternoon trip of the twice-daily route. It now leaves Eugene Station at 3:20 instead of 3:15.

Route 66 - VRC/Coburg

Removal of the 3:20 p.m. and 5:20 p.m. weekday trips, and moved up the following trips so that a bus now runs every half hour instead of every 20 minutes during those times.

Route 67 - Coburg/VRC

Removal of the 10 a.m. and 5:20 p.m. trips, and moved the 5:40 p.m. trip forward 10 minutes to begin at 5:30 instead.
